Integrated multi-objective model predictive control framework for cascaded open-channel systems with multi-source lateral inflows

• A Multi-source Lateral Inflow Integrator–Delay (MLIID) model is developed. • A feedforward guided MPC framework embeds optimized allocation as references. • A radar chart-based method integrates multi-objective trade-offs in real time. • Case study shows improved prediction accuracy and expanded Pareto frontier. • Framework supports resilient and sustainable operation of inter-basin transfers.
